Golden Dawn Member Gets Off Lightly
- Written by E.Tsiliopoulos
Golden Dawn candidate for parliament, Themis Skordeli is being charged with misdemeanors by prosecution leading media to speak of her being let off lightly.
The charges include possession of fireworks, forgery, and infringement of copyright laws. She will face the judge this Friday.
During a search of her house police found fireworks, lists of houses and the nationality of inhabitants, a bankbook showing deposits of 140,000 euros, and two bags of pirated CDs.
As she was Ms Skordeli stated that the bankbook was from 1974 and showed deposits of 140,000 drachmas.
When asked why she had been arrested, she retorted, "because they're chasing Golden Dawn."
